We have demonstrated for the first time in our knowledge optical label-based wavelength switching and packet drop over actual field fiber. We have shown SCM-formatted optical labeling transmission with less than 2 dB power penalty for both label and payload over 476 km of fiber. The optical label switching achieves packet drop and re-transmission of the remaining packet.
